我是靠谱客的博主 可耐星月,最近开发中收集的这篇文章主要介绍OVS基本操作,觉得挺不错的,现在分享给大家,希望可以做个参考。

概述

ovsdb-server -v --remote=punix:/var/run/openvswitch/db.sock – //启动调试模式
ovsdb-tool create /usr/local/etc/openvswitch/conf.db vswitchd/vswitch.ovsschema //根据schema创建数据库
rm -f /usr/local/etc/openvswitch/conf.db//删除数据库
ovs-vswitchd unix:/var/run/openvswitch/db.sock --pidfile -detach //启动ovs
2.ovsdb-client monitor-cond _Server ‘[[“name”,"==",“Open_vSwitch”]]’ Database ‘cid,connected,index,leader,model,name,schema,sid’
3.ovsdb-client monitor-cond Open_vSwitch ‘[]’ Port ‘fake_bridge,interfaces,name,tag’
4.ovsdb-client monitor-cond Open_vSwitch ‘[]’ Open_vSwitch ‘bridges’
5.ovsdb-client monitor-cond Open_vSwitch ‘[]’ Controller ‘target’
6.ovsdb-client monitor-cond Open_vSwitch ‘[]’ Interface ‘error,name,ofport’
7.ovsdb-client monitor-cond Open_vSwitch ‘[]’ Bridge ‘fail_mode,name,ports’
以上5步不知怎么回事为生成临时的表。每个表包含一个row,row的意思应该是代表这一行,和一个action,action代表状态:initial为初始状态
8.ovsdb-client transact
这里为之前的op:wait 通过上个步骤生成临时的行
通过[uuid-name] Insert Birdge [依赖Port “row”:{“name”:“br9”,“ports”:不知道这个named-uuid怎么生成[“named-uuid”,“row4ef0e9a4_6f41_4557_a4c6_b6a074c5c72c”]}]->[uuid-name == named-uuid]insert Port [named-uuid]->
->update OpenSwitch [named-uuid 为第一个表的uuid-name]此处为更新根表;
9.添加注释

内核模块加载
/sbin/modprobe openvswitch

/sbin/lsmod | grep openvswitch

sudo /usr/share/openvswitch/scripts/ovs-ctl start

ovs-ofctl dump-flows br0 -OOpenFlow13

systemctl stop openvswitch.service 停止ovs
rmmod openvswitch 卸载内核
ovs-dpctl del-dp system@ovs-system 删除网桥
lsmod | grep openvswitch 查看内核是否加载
rpm -e openvswitch-kmod-2.6.1-15_3.4.0.baicells.el72.centos.x86_64 卸载内核
rpm -ivh openvswitch-kmod-2.6.1-15_3.4.0.baicells.el72.centos.x86_64.rpm
modprobe openvswitch 加载
systemctl restart openvswitch.service 重新
systemctl restart ovs-init.service
systemctl restart onos
systemctl restart epc

tc 命令对qos规则的管理
tc qsdic
sar 监控命令
nload 监控
ovsdb-client
ovsdb-vsctl

最后

以上就是可耐星月为你收集整理的OVS基本操作的全部内容,希望文章能够帮你解决OVS基本操作所遇到的程序开发问题。

如果觉得靠谱客网站的内容还不错,欢迎将靠谱客网站推荐给程序员好友。

本图文内容来源于网友提供,作为学习参考使用,或来自网络收集整理,版权属于原作者所有。
点赞(40)

评论列表共有 0 条评论

立即
投稿
返回
顶部